Bite Your Tongue or Say Your Peace? Today, Mike and Aydian delve into the always entertaining world of interacting with your family during the holidays. From dated humor to political view, the holidays can be a minefield of emotions and opinions. When do you say something? When is it appropriate and when is it not? Mike and Aydian answer these questions and more, along with providing helpful tips for navigating difficult topics without compromising your boundaries.

What is The State of Men?

The State of Men is hosted by two Elder Millennial work-from-home-Dads, Mike Watts (cis man) and Aydian Dowling (trans man).

A funny and real-life approach to being Men in the 2020s The State of Men is taking a deep dive into masculinity to talk about what we do, and why we do it.

We believe a better future for our world is in part the responsibility of the Men in it. We invite all men to do the work and fix their shit, so we can leave a legacy we are proud of.

Societally, men have been brainwashed into a narrow view of masculinity through which they can't see their full potential. Gender norms are changing, the glass ceiling is shattered, and home life has been reinvented. So what does it mean to be a man in this new world?

The State of Men is a funny, honest, real-world look at the stigmas that exist around men.
